Description
Technical Field
The invention relates to a device and a method for recovering residual honey in a honey barrel.
Background
At present, along with honey is widely used by people, the value of honey is approved, because in the mill of processing production honey, the raw materials all come from the honey that beekeeper provided, the in-process of beekeeper transportation honey almost all adopts the honey bucket transportation, when pouring honey in the workshop, because honey has the adhesion, often can attach to the bottom and the inside wall of honey bucket, the adhesion volume accounts for the minority of whole honey, if abandon it, then very extravagant. Most enterprises all adopt when facing this problem to dissolve the honey that remains in the honey bucket through adding water, then concentrate the recovery, not only the waste time, work efficiency is reduced, still can increase the manufacturing cost of enterprise, and destroy the original purity of honey like this through watered honey at the concentration, and do not use an effectual solution method to handle and remain honey, the honey of honey barrel head portion can be through the mobility realization recovery that the mode of bottom heating increased honey, but be attached to the honey heating of honey bucket inner wall all around is more difficult, the low heating efficiency, so need provide a recovery unit who retrieves the residual honey of honey bucket inner wall all around, and need improve the flexibility of using.
Disclosure of Invention
Aiming at the defects of the prior art, the invention solves the problems that: provides a device and a method for recovering residual honey in honey barrels, which can quickly recover the peripheral inner walls of the honey barrels, can move transversely and adapt to different diameters.

Detailed Description
The present invention will be described in further detail with reference to the accompanying drawings.
As shown in fig. 1 to 2, a device for recovering residual honey in a honey barrel comprises an outer tank body 1, a top plate 2, a transverse floating rotating mechanism 3, a honey barrel 4 and a scraping plate 6; a honey barrel 4 is arranged below the inner part of the outer tank body 1; a circular containing groove is formed in the honey barrel 4; the top plate 2 is arranged at the upper end of the outer tank body 1; the transverse floating rotating mechanism 3 comprises a rotating rod 31, a driving rod 32, an external thread head 33, a longitudinal sliding block 34, a transverse sliding block 36, a limiting rod 39, a guide rod 37 and a connecting rod 38; the rotating rod 31 is rotatably clamped in the middle of the top plate 2; the lower end of the rotating rod 31 extends to the inside of the honey barrel 4; a rotating cavity 312 extending from top to bottom is arranged in the rotating rod 31; a driving rod 32 is rotationally clamped and installed in the rotating cavity 312; the lower end of the drive rod 32 extends downwardly below the exterior of the rotating cavity 312; the lower end of the driving rod 32 is provided with an external thread head 33; an internal thread channel 341 is arranged in the middle of the interior of the longitudinal sliding block 34; the longitudinal sliding block 34 is connected to the external thread head 33 through the internal thread passage 341 in a threaded and rotating manner; the upper end of the longitudinal sliding block 34 is guided to slide up and down through a guide rod 37; two connecting rods 38 are respectively arranged on two sides of the lower end of the longitudinal sliding block 34; the outer end of the connecting rod 38 extends obliquely upwards and is connected with a transverse sliding block 36; the outer sides of the transverse sliding blocks 36 are respectively provided with a scraper 6; the inner end of the connecting rod 38 is rotatably connected to the outer side of the longitudinal sliding block 34 through a rotating shaft 381, and the outer end of the connecting rod 38 is rotatably connected to the inner side of the transverse sliding block 36 through a rotating shaft 381; two limiting rods 39 are respectively arranged on two sides below the rotating rod 31; the upper end of the transverse sliding block 36 is transversely clamped at the lower end of the limiting rod 39 in a sliding manner; the invention can arrange a wear-resistant coating on the outer edge of the scraper 6.
As shown in fig. 1 to 2, it is further preferable that a driving groove 311 is provided at an upper end of the rotating cavity 312; the upper end of the drive rod 32 extends into the drive slot 311. Further, two sides of the upper end of the longitudinal sliding block 34 are respectively provided with a guide groove 342; two sides of the lower end of the rotating rod 31 are respectively provided with a guide rod 37; the longitudinal sliding block 34 is slidably sleeved on the guide rods 37 at two sides of the lower end of the rotating rod 31 up and down through the guide grooves 342 at two sides of the upper end. Further, a transverse clamping sliding groove 361 is arranged at the upper end of the transverse sliding block 36; the transverse sliding block 36 is slidably clamped at the lower end of the limiting rod 39 through a transverse clamping sliding groove 361 at the upper end. Further, a side positioning mechanism 5 is also included; the side positioning mechanism 5 comprises a side sliding rod 52, a positioning screw 51 and a clamping plate 53; two side positioning mechanisms 5 are respectively arranged on two sides below the outer tank body 1; two sides below the outer tank body 1 are respectively provided with a thread through hole 11; a positioning groove 12 is respectively arranged at the upper part and the lower part of the inner side of the thread through hole 11; the thread through holes 11 are respectively connected with a positioning screw rod 51 in a thread through way; the inner ends of the positioning screws 51 are respectively provided with a clamping plate 53 in a rotating and clamping way; a side sliding rod 52 is respectively arranged at the upper part and the lower part of the outer side of the clamping plate 53; the outer ends of the side sliding rods 52 are respectively connected in the positioning grooves 12 in a sliding manner. Furthermore, the limiting rod is of an L-shaped structure. Further, the longitudinal section of the outer tank body 1 is in a U-shaped structure.
As shown in fig. 1 to 2, a method for recovering residual honey in a honey barrel comprises the following steps: the honey barrel 4 is placed in the middle of the bottom of the outer tank body 1, then the top plate 2 is arranged at the upper end of the outer tank body 1, the driving rod 31 is rotated to drive the longitudinal sliding block 34 to move up and down on the external thread head 33, thereby driving the connecting rod 35 to move up and down and rotate, driving the transverse sliding block 36 to move transversely, finally driving the scraping plates 6 to move transversely, enabling the two scraping plates 6 to be abutted against the peripheral inner wall of the honey barrel 4, so as to adjust the distance between the two scraping plates 6, so as to adapt to honey barrels with different diameters, and finally, the rotating rod 31 is rotated to drive the two scraping plates 6 to rotate, so that the residual honey on the inner walls around the honey barrel 4 is attached to the scraping plates 6, then the driving rod 32 is rotated reversely so that the scraping plate 6 is separated from the inner wall of the honey barrel 4, and then the whole top plate 2 and the transverse floating rotation mechanism 3 are drawn out to recover honey from the scraping plate 6.
According to the honey scraping machine, residual honey on the inner walls of the periphery of the honey barrel 4 can be scraped and recovered through the rotary scraping plates 6, the distance between the two scraping plates 6 can be synchronously adjusted, so that the honey barrel can be matched with honey barrels with different diameters, and the honey scraping machine can be used more flexibly.
